The commander of the Israeli army once again warned the Islamic Republic and its proxy forces about the consequences of 'further attacks on Israel.' Lieutenant General Herzi Halevi, Chief of Staff of the Israeli army, warned on Wednesday, December 26, during a graduation ceremony for Israeli pilots, that the Islamic Republic of Iran and its proxies, as well as the entire Middle East, must know that 'whoever seeks to undermine the stability and security of the State of Israel, the Israeli army will stand firm against them and is ready to attack at any time and place.' Halevi also considered the return of the remaining 100 hostages held by Hamas in Gaza as an 'urgent moral duty' of Israel and emphasized that the army will take all necessary actions to ensure their return home. The Israeli government previously rejected claims by the Palestinian militant group Hamas regarding Israel's attempts to delay the release of hostages and ceasefire agreements in the Gaza Strip, accusing Hamas of creating 'new obstacles' to reaching an agreement. In a statement released by the office of Benjamin Netanyahu, the Prime Minister of Israel, on Wednesday, December 26, it was stated: 'The terrorist organization Hamas is lying again, deviating from the agreements that have been reached so far, and continuing to create new obstacles in the path of negotiations.' During the terrorist attack by Hamas on October 7, 2023, more than 1,200 residents, mostly civilians, were killed, and over 250 others, including women, children, and the elderly, were taken hostage. In response to this attack, Israel launched an offensive on Gaza aimed at destroying Hamas and recovering the kidnapped hostages. Reports indicate that the Gaza war, which began with the terrorist attack by Hamas on Israeli citizens, has so far resulted in the deaths of tens of thousands and the displacement of residents in the region. While about 100 hostages were exchanged for Palestinian prisoners during a temporary ceasefire late last fall, around 100 remain in captivity with Hamas, and reports suggest that some of them have been killed. The Hamas group is listed as a terrorist organization by the United States, the European Union, the United Kingdom, Israel, Canada, Japan, and several other countries.
